For some reason, I can't get linkage to work for skills. I created a new system based off the Sample author kit and added skills in, but the Attribute bonuses never add in. This is also true with the brand new, unmodified sample system generated with the kit (add to all Attributes, no bonus shows up for skills, add to skills and the number remains that value). I've run the Sample kit and the behavior is the same. Is my understanding wrong? I'm expecting the Attribute to add (be linked) to the Skill value. If that's not the intent, how would I go about doing that (since everything I've read seems to imply that's what should be happening)?

None of the displays for skills in the skeleton/sample game systems display the sklRoll field, which is what incorporates the attribute values - they all display trtFinal (just the value of the skill). Find the displays of those fields in tab_basics.dat and summ_abilities.dat and change which field they're displaying.

Or, (with "enable data file debugging" turned on in the develop menu), right click the skill, and select "show debug fields for XXX" - and you can see all the field values that apply to a thing.
